Canonical released after six months their Ubuntu 20.04.3 LTS point release with Ubuntu 20.04.3 LTS now available to download with Linux kernel 5.11 and Mesa 3D 21 Drivers, Ubuntu 20.04.3 LTS is a complete desktop Linux operating system, freely available with both community and professional support. The Ubuntu community is built on the ideas enshrined in the Ubuntu Manifesto: that software should be available free of charge, that software tools should be usable by people in their local language and despite any disabilities, and that people should have the freedom to customize and alter their software in whatever way they see fit. “Ubuntu” is an ancient African word, meaning “humanity to others”. The Ubuntu distribution brings the spirit of Ubuntu to the software world. Ubuntu 20.04.3 comes with Linux kernel 5.11 which was support to newer hardware with clean installation, although older installed system just upgrade with patch and packages, Ubuntu 20.04.3 Comes with Gnome 3.36.8 by default, updated Ubuntu 20.04.3 iso file comes with all the upgraded latest packages after install you don’t need to perform package upgrade [hide][Hidden Content]]
